A fun listening album that takes you back to the days of Ella Fitzgerald and Duke Ellington. This band takes the sound from the 30’s and 40’s era of jazz and recreates the songs for an easy listen to will calm any nerves. Check out tracks 1 “Slow Down”, track 2 “Shout Sister Shout”, track 7 “Carolina Moon”, track 8 “Miss Otis Regrets”, and track 11 “It’s Only A Paper Moon”. -Lane
